In May 2014 the general managers of the regional employers federations of Bolivia met  in Santa Cruz de la Sierra to discuss business parks development in their region and the way employers could be involved.  During the  two days event, organized by the local Federación de Empresarios Privados de Santa Cruz with financial support by DECP, the managers visited the PADI industrial park and the Parque Industrial Latino Americano in nearby Warnes.

The actual workshop of the general managers took place on the second day. Among the topics discussed were effective lobbying and the issue of corporate social responsibility. During the workshop Ms.Roos Stolker, a Dutch expert on urban development, gave a presentation on the development of business parks in the Netherlands. She emphasized that industrial parks should be developed in such a way that they can cope with future challenges. Federations should also work out a joint vision about energy saving and how to deal with risks for the environment, she explained.

Ms. Stolker is an expert of PUM  (the Netherlands’senior experts programme), an ONG and DECP’s sister organization.  PUM  links entrepreneurs in developing countries and emerging markets with senior experts from the Netherlands, who provide their expertise free-of-charge for short-term, solid consultancy projects on the workfloor.  Ms.Stolker also visited La Paz and Sucre to provide more detailed advice to regional federations and authorities.

This kind of close cooperation between DECP and PUM was a first for Bolivia.
